North Woolwich Station including turntable and platform lamp standards, Pier Road, North Woolwich E16 - Newham

Former railway station, 1847. Extensive works are needed to the roof, and the rear canopy has been dismantled following partial collapse. Essential remedial works were carried out prior to sale of the building. New owners have submitted applications for Planning Permission and Listed Building Consent for repair and conversion of the building into a place of worship. The applications have been refused as the proposals were considered to harm the heritage significance of the building.
